Transaction 0435140d7e3af334b86cadcae02970c3a5510112050ef2c320c5f000e29d22e4
2 Input
2 Outputs
- 0435140d7e3af334b86cadcae02970c3a5510112050ef2c320c5f000e29d22e4:0
- 0435140d7e3af334b86cadcae02970c3a5510112050ef2c320c5f000e29d22e4:1
value 2496859
address 13rMxSDqrXK72ukwnxoUfk8SrzwSRxVziV
value 87821330
address 3BFxG7cmcVj6GGu8UzjbGxkc5aVvjd9yyk